Why the Basement Is Summer’s Best Room
Below ground level, basements stay naturally cooler than the rest of the home. That built-in advantage means lower cooling costs and a comfortable retreat on the hottest afternoons. Instead of letting that square footage sit unused, a smart remodel turns it into the most popular room in the house once temperatures spike.
Functional Ideas for an Entertainment-Ready Basement
Home Theater or Media Room
The basement’s cool, low-light setting is ideal for a movie room. Comfortable seating, good sound, and a large screen create a destination the whole family will use all summer.
Game and Hangout Zone
A pool table, gaming setup, or open lounge gives kids and guests somewhere to gather out of the heat. It keeps the activity downstairs and the upstairs calm.
Wet Bar or Kitchenette
A small bar or kitchenette means no running upstairs for drinks and snacks during a gathering. It instantly elevates the space for hosting.
Guest Suite
Summer brings visitors. A finished basement with a sleeping area and bathroom gives guests privacy and comfort while keeping the rest of the home free.
Planning Your Basement Project
A successful basement remodel starts with managing moisture, lighting, and layout. Proper sealing keeps the space dry, while thoughtful lighting makes a windowless room feel warm and welcoming. Getting these fundamentals right is what turns a basement from storage into a true living space.
